Your cart

Your cart is empty

Check out these collections.

Christmas Shirts

65 Results

Truck & Tree Tee [Tartan Plaid Mix]

Truck & Tree Tee [Tartan Plaid Mix]

from $42.00

Unit price
per 

5 sizes
  • Small
  • Medium
  • Large
  • XL
  • 2XL
Christmas Wonderland Tee [Mint]

Christmas Wonderland Tee [Mint]

from $36.00

Unit price
per 

5 sizes
  • Small
  • Medium
  • Large
  • XL
  • 2XL
Buffalo Plaid Trucker Hat

Buffalo Plaid Trucker Hat

$32.00

Unit price
per 

Double Heart Tee [Buffalo Plaid Mix]

Double Heart Tee [Buffalo Plaid Mix]

from $42.00

Unit price
per 

6 sizes
  • XS
  • Small
  • Medium
  • Large
  • XL
  • 2XL
Buffalo Plaid Mouse Oatmeal Tee

Buffalo Plaid Mouse Oatmeal Tee

$42.00

Unit price
per 

6 sizes
  • XS
  • Small
  • Medium
  • Large
  • XL
  • 2XL
Truck & Tree Tee [Salsa Mix]

Truck & Tree Tee [Salsa Mix]

from $42.00

Unit price
per 

7 sizes
  • XS
  • Small
  • Medium
  • Large
  • XL
  • 2XL
  • 3XL
Truck & Tree Tee [Buffalo Plaid Mix]

Truck & Tree Tee [Buffalo Plaid Mix]

from $42.00

Unit price
per 

6 sizes
  • XS
  • Small
  • Medium
  • Large
  • XL
  • 2XL
Christmas Tree Trifecta Red Pullover

Christmas Tree Trifecta Red Pullover

from $59.00

Unit price
per 

6 sizes
  • XS
  • Small
  • Medium
  • Large
  • XL
  • 2XL
Christmas Tree Trifecta Tee

Christmas Tree Trifecta Tee

from $42.00

Unit price
per 

7 sizes
  • XS
  • Small
  • Medium
  • Large
  • XL
  • 2XL
  • 3XL
Buffalo Plaid Flannel Sherpa Blanket

Buffalo Plaid Flannel Sherpa Blanket

$50.00

Unit price
per 

1 size
  • 25x25
Buffalo Plaid Long Sleeve Tee

Buffalo Plaid Long Sleeve Tee

from $38.00

Unit price
per 

6 sizes
  • XS
  • Small
  • Medium
  • Large
  • XL
  • 2XL
Buffalo Plaid Onesie

Buffalo Plaid Onesie

$25.00

Unit price
per 

3 sizes
  • 3-6 months
  • 6-12 months
  • 12-18 months
Vintage Christmas Tree Ornament
Sale

Vintage Christmas Tree Ornament

Regular price $8.00 $5.00 Sale

Unit price
per 

4 colors
Fiesta Christmas Ornaments [All Colors]
Sold out

Fiesta Christmas Ornaments [All Colors]

$15.00

Unit price
per 

7 colors
  • +2 more
Buffalo Plaid Key Hole Tee

Buffalo Plaid Key Hole Tee

from $28.00

Unit price
per 

7 sizes
  • XS
  • Small
  • Medium
  • Large
  • XL
  • 2XL
  • 3XL
Buffalo Plaid Tee

Buffalo Plaid Tee

from $36.00

Unit price
per 

6 sizes
  • X-Small
  • Small
  • Medium
  • Large
  • XL
  • 2XL